Abstract

The invention discloses a tester of a relaying protection system, which comprises a shell. A mainboard is installed in the shell and provided with a chip, a time controller, a GPS module and a modulator-demodulator; a power supply is also arranged in the shell, and a data pin is arranged at the top of the shell; the side wall of the shell is provided with a display panel groove the inner wall of which is proved with a cooling window; the display panel groove is internally provided with a display panel the back of which is provided with a bracket groove; a bracket is installed in the bracket groove; the inner wall of the display panel groove is provided with a positioning groove; two side walls of the shell are respectively provided with a sliding groove; each sliding groove is internally provided with a sliding shaft; each sliding shaft is provided with a sliding shaft base; a manipulation panel is arranged between the two sliding shaft bases and provided with a data slot. The relaying protection system tester can solve the problems of the prior art, meet the requirements of a working environment, is convenient for operators to operate in standing posture; in addition, a display is hidden in the manipulation panel and can not be damaged easily.

Background technology
Relay protection and automatic safety device are the important component parts of electric system, and the protection of supertension line employing at present is longitudinal differential protection.At present loaded down with trivial details to the debug process of longitudinal differential protection, and only when electricity is sent in the first examination of circuit, the pilot protection passage is debugged, the circuit two ends need get in touch with through phone during debugging, and a side cooperates a side verification, complex steps.The more important thing is that existing all kinds of relaying protection system devices exist display to expose; Be prone to scratched or damage by external items, and, because working environment needs; Operating personnel's operation of how need standing during detection, the position keyboard of existing survey checking device is inconvenient to use.

Tester of relaying protection system of the present invention comprises housing 1, and for being convenient for carrying and putting, housing 1 can be a rectangle; Mainboard 13 is installed in the housing 1; Chip 14, time controller 15, GPS module 16 and modulator-demodular unit 17 are installed on the mainboard 13; Power supply 18 is installed in the housing 1; The top of housing 1 is provided with data pin 22, and mainboard 13 is connected with power supply 18 through lead, and mainboard 13 is connected with data pin 22 through data line; Offer display surface board slot 11 on the sidewall of housing 1, offer heat radiation window 19 on the inwall of display surface board slot 11, display panel 3 is installed in the display surface board slot 11; The top of display panel 3 and housing 1 are hinged; The syndeton of display panel 3 and housing 1 and circuit relationships can be identical with the annexation of the display of notebook computer and main frame, and the various places of the processing of mainboard 13 show that according to all being transferred on the display panel 3 bracket groove 8 is offered at display panel 3 rear portions; Mounting bracket 9 in the bracket groove 8; One end of support 9 and display panel 3 are hinged, and offer locating slot 12 on the inwall of display surface board slot 11, respectively offer a chute 4 on the two side of housing 1; In the every chute 4 slide-bar 6 is installed; Fitting operation panel 2 between 5, two slide-bar seats 5 of a slide-bar seat is installed on the every slide-bar 6, data slot 23 is set on the guidance panel 2; Data slot 23 is connected with guidance panel 2 interior circuit boards through lead, and data slot 23 and data pin 22 annexations can be identical with the structural relation of associated socket on the mouse plug of existing computer and the main frame.As shown in Figure 2; Heat radiation window 19 is opened on the inwall of display surface board slot 11, can guarantee under non-working condition, and heat radiation window 19 is a closure state; But just ventilation heat exchanges of window 19 only dispel the heat when display panel under the user mode 3 is opened; Can prevent effectively that the external environment dust from getting in the housing 1, play the good dust-proof effect, guarantee that each parts in the housing 1 normally move.
During use, earlier guidance panel 2 is upwards started to horizontal direction; Promote guidance panel 2 along chute 4 again, make guidance panel 2 be positioned at position shown in Figure 2, data pin 22 is pegged graft with data slot 23 cooperate, make that the circuit board in the guidance panel 2 is connected with mainboard 13; Then, display panel 3 is opened, and opened support 9, an end of support 9 is placed in the locating slot 12,9 pairs of display panels 3 of support play a supportive role, and at this moment, can operate tester of relaying protection system, carry out each item and detect.
For guaranteeing that guidance panel 2 closed back tester of relaying protection system are shut down automatically, shut down switch 24 is installed on the sidewall of housing 1, shut down switch 24 is connected with mainboard 13 through lead, and shut down switch 24 is positioned at the below of display panel 3.When guidance panel 2 closures, guidance panel 2 can touch shut down switch 24, and tester of relaying protection system is shut down automatically.
For being convenient for carrying tester of relaying protection system of the present invention, as shown in Figure 3, handle groove 20 is offered at the top of housing 1, handle installation 21 in the handle groove 20, and handle 21 is hinged with housing 1.
For preventing to display panel 3 maloperations, guarantee to have only when the top is opened and put to guidance panel 2 and just can display panel 3 upsets be opened, do not receive extraneous the damage to guarantee display panel 3; As shown in Figure 2, rotating shaft 30 is installed in the housing 1, lever 34 is installed in the rotating shaft 30; Offer first gathering sill 31 and second gathering sill 32 on the lever 34, the periphery of rotating shaft 30 is installed torsion spring 33, and an end of torsion spring 33 is connected with housing 1 sidewall; The other end of torsion spring 33 is connected with lever 34, and torsion spring 33 provides the power that resets and rotate for lever 34, and first connecting rod 27 and second connecting rod 28 are installed on the lever 34; First pin 35 of first connecting rod 27 is positioned at first gathering sill 31, and second pin 36 of second connecting rod 28 is positioned at second gathering sill 32, and button 25 is installed in the upper end of first connecting rod 27; Offer gathering sill 26 on the housing 1, button 25 is positioned at gathering sill 26, and orienting lug 29 is set in the housing 1; Second connecting rod 28 is offered pilot hole 37 on the inwall of display surface board slot 11 between the sidewall of orienting lug 29 and housing 1, installing and locating hook 38 on the display panel 3; Location hook 38 is corresponding with pilot hole 37; In the time of in the display panel 3 closed income display surface board slots 11, location hook 38 inserts in the pilot hole 37, and cooperates display panel 3 lockings with second connecting rod 28.When guidance panel 2 being opened and after level promotes to put the top; Guidance panel 2 can touch button 25; Button 25 drives first connecting rod 27 and moves downward; First connecting rod 27 drives second connecting rod 28 through lever 34 and moves upward, and makes second connecting rod 28 lose the effect of contraction to location hook 38, thereby can display panel 3 be opened.
